The Importance of Warm-ups and Safety First

Safety first, guys! Before even thinking about jumping, you need to prepare your body. Warm-ups are absolutely crucial for preventing injuries and making sure your muscles are ready to perform. Start with some light cardio, like jogging in place or jumping jacks, to get your blood flowing. Then, focus on dynamic stretching, which involves moving your body through a range of motions. Think arm circles, leg swings, and torso twists. These will help improve your flexibility and mobility. Also, it’s really important to find a safe space to practice. Ideally, you want a soft surface like a gym floor, a grassy area, or even a trampoline (if you have access to one). Avoid practicing on concrete or other hard surfaces, especially when you're just starting out. Make sure the area is clear of any obstacles, and have a spotter if possible, especially when trying new moves. A spotter can provide guidance and support, and they can also help prevent you from getting injured. Remember, progress is the goal, but injuries can really hamper your ability to do what you love, so be sure to take every possible precaution.

Essential Body Positions for Mastering TikTok Jumps

There are several body positions that you’ll need to master to perform the TikTok viral jumps you want to create. First up is the basic stance.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, knees slightly bent, and your core engaged. This is your base, your foundation. Next is the jump position This is the pre-jump movement. This involves bending your knees and swinging your arms. This position helps you generate the power you need to propel yourself upwards. Next, is the landing position. A good landing is just as important as the jump itself. Bend your knees as you land to absorb the impact. Keep your core engaged and your back straight. Avoid locking your knees, as this can lead to injuries. Lastly, is the tucked position. This position is used for rotations. Bring your knees towards your chest and pull your head down. This helps you to rotate in the air. Mastering these positions is the key to creating those viral jumps. And it also ensures that you land safely and avoid any possible injuries. It takes practice, but the more you practice these techniques, the better you’ll get.

Different Types of Jumps and Basic Moves

Now, let's get into some of the basic moves. Remember to start slow, and focus on mastering each move before moving on to the next. The first one is the straight jump. This is your basic jump. Jump straight up, and land softly. Easy, right? It might sound simple, but it's important to master this before trying anything else. Next is the tuck jump. Jump up, and pull your knees towards your chest. This is a great way to start learning about rotations. Now let's try the straddle jump. Jump up, and spread your legs out to the sides. This is a great way to add some flair to your jumps. Now, the turn jump. This will get you accustomed to turning mid-air. Jump up and rotate your body in one direction. Try to keep your head up and eyes focused on where you are going. This will help with your balance. And, finally, the front flip. This is a more advanced move, and you should only attempt it after you’ve mastered the other moves and have a safe environment. Jump up, and rotate your body forward. These are just some of the basics. Don’t worry about creating all of them at once. Each move you complete will help with the next one. With each new move, the more comfortable you will get with the different movements and positions.

Mastering Rotations and Flips

Now, let's talk about rotations and flips. These are the moves that really get the views, but they also require a lot of skill and practice. The key to successful rotations is body control and momentum. The tuck jump is a great way to start learning about rotations. Bring your knees towards your chest, and pull your head down. This will help you rotate in the air. When it comes to flips, start with a safe environment, like a trampoline or a foam pit. For a front flip, jump up and rotate your body forward. Keep your head tucked in, and try to spot your landing. For a backflip, jump up and rotate your body backward. Again, keep your head tucked in, and try to spot your landing. Progress slowly and safely. Practice the basics first, and work your way up to more advanced moves. When starting to learn flips, it's also helpful to have a spotter. A spotter can help guide you and provide support, especially when you're just starting out. Never rush the process, and always prioritize safety. This will help you learn the moves correctly and prevent injuries. Remember, with enough practice and dedication, you can master these moves and create some amazing TikTok viral jumps!

Filming and Editing Your Jump Videos

Okay, so you've got the moves, now you need to film them! Here's how to create videos that look great and keep viewers hooked. First, lighting. Make sure you film in a well-lit area. Natural light is best, but if you don't have access to natural light, use some artificial lights. Next is the angle. Experiment with different angles to make your videos more dynamic. Try filming from different perspectives, like low angles or high angles. Then, you have the composition. Frame your shots carefully. Make sure your subject is centered in the frame. And, finally, the editing. Use a video editing app to add music, text, and special effects. Keep your videos short and engaging. And don’t forget to trim any unnecessary parts. Also, consider the style. You can add things such as slow-motion effects, and transitions to create a unique and visually appealing video. And finally, use a good camera, and try to keep your videos in high definition. The higher quality your video, the better it will look! By following these simple tips, you can create high-quality videos that will capture the attention of your audience.

Choosing the Right Environment and Equipment

Choosing the right environment is super important for staying safe. You will need to start practicing on a soft surface, like a gym floor, a grassy area, or a trampoline. Avoid practicing on concrete or other hard surfaces, especially when you're just starting out. Before even starting, check the environment and clear the area of any obstacles. Also, make sure you have enough space to move around freely. Use the right equipment. Wear comfortable clothing that allows you to move freely. Consider using wrist guards, knee pads, and a helmet, especially when practicing new moves. And if you have a trampoline, make sure it is in good condition. The safety pads are still good, and the springs are still intact. The more you pay attention to the environment, the safer you'll be. This will let you focus on what you're doing without having to worry about an injury.
